Code P0C82 Cadillac Description
The P0C82 diagnostic trouble code (DTC) for Cadillac vehicles indicates a problem with the Hybrid/EV Battery Temperature Sensor 8 Performance. This sensor is responsible for monitoring the temperature of the hybrid or electric vehicle battery to ensure it operates within a safe and efficient range. When this sensor detects that the battery temperature is not within the expected parameters, it triggers the P0C82 code.
Common Causes of P0C82 Cadillac
- Faulty sensor: The most common cause of the P0C82 code is a malfunctioning battery temperature sensor itself.
- Wiring issues: Corrosion, damage, or loose connections in the wiring harness connected to the sensor can also trigger this code.
- Software glitch: Sometimes, a software issue within the vehicle's system can cause the sensor to provide inaccurate readings.
- Battery temperature fluctuations: Extreme temperature changes or fluctuations can also impact the performance of the battery temperature sensor.
- Battery coolant system malfunction: Problems with the battery coolant system, which helps regulate the battery temperature, can lead to issues with the sensor.

How to Fix P0C82 Cadillac
- Diagnose the issue: The first step in repairing the P0C82 code is to diagnose the specific cause of the problem. This may involve using a scan tool to read the code and perform additional tests to pinpoint the issue.
- Inspect the sensor and wiring: Check the battery temperature sensor and its wiring for any visible damage, corrosion, or loose connections. Replace or repair any faulty components as needed.
- Test the sensor: Perform a test on the battery temperature sensor to ensure it is functioning correctly and providing accurate readings.
- Check the battery coolant system: Inspect the battery coolant system to ensure it is operating properly and maintaining the correct temperature for the battery.
- Clear the code: Once the repairs have been completed, clear the P0C82 code from the vehicle's system to reset the warning lights and monitor the sensor's performance.
Cost to Fix P0C82 Cadillac
The typical repair costs for addressing the P0C82 code can vary depending on the specific cause of the issue and the extent of the repairs needed. On average, the cost of replacing a battery temperature sensor and addressing related issues can range from $200 to $500, including parts and labor.
